Granulated white sugar is important in this recipe; substituting another sweetener won’t give you quite the right texture. However, if strict veganism is important to you, make sure to use a granulated sugar that is labeled as such. Cane sugar can involve bone char in the refining process, so some folks don’t consider it vegan. Sugar derived from beets, on the other hand, is always vegan, and that’s what we use at Tandem. At Tandem we mix individual flour blends for each recipe, but most folks don’t keep this many flours and starches on hand at home. We have experimented with substituting store-bought gluten-free flour blends in this recipe with mixed results. If you decide to try a store-bought blend, look for one that is vegan, with no dairy products (including whey) or eggs, and that includes xanthan gum.
